Sunday Morning Dutch Baby

My Sunday morning treat to you all is the recipe for my moms famous Dutch Baby.


All you need to do is put 2 tablespoons of butter in a cake pan and then pop the cake pan in a 425 degree oven until the butter is melted.

While it's melting, mix together half a cup of flour, half a cup of milk, and 2 eggs in a magic bullet or the like.

Pour the batter on top of the melted butter in the cake pan and bake in the oven until they "pop" or for about 15 minutes.

Dust them with powdered sugar and squeeze some lemon on top immediately and serve.
